Latest CVEs
The 7 most recently published vulnerabilities affecting Oracle insurance rules palette.
- CVE-2020-25649A flaw was found in FasterXML Jackson Databind, where it did not have entity expansion secured properly. This flaw allows vulnerability to XML external entity (XXE) attacks. The highest threat from...7.5
- CVE-2020-9488Improper validation of certificate with host mismatch in Apache Log4j SMTP appender. This could allow an SMTPS connection to be intercepted by a man-in-the-middle attack which could leak any log me...3.7
- CVE-2020-5397CSRF Attack via CORS Preflight Requests with Spring MVC or Spring WebFlux5.3
- CVE-2020-5398RFD Attack via "Content-Disposition" Header Sourced from Request Input by Spring MVC or Spring WebFlux Application7.5
- CVE-2019-12415In Apache POI up to 4.1.0, when using the tool XSSFExportToXml to convert user-provided Microsoft Excel documents, a specially crafted document can allow an attacker to read files from the local fi...5.5
- CVE-2018-15756DoS Attack via Range Requests7.5
- CVE-2018-1258Spring Framework version 5.0.5 when used in combination with any versions of Spring Security contains an authorization bypass when using method security. An unauthorized malicious user can gain una...8.8
